Bengals lose defensive tackle to injury

One of Cincinnati’s best run-stoppers will no longer be in the defensive line rotation for the Bengals.

Fourth-year defensive tackle Pat Sims injured his ankle against Cleveland on Nov. 27 and was put on injured reserve Wednesday, ending his season. Sims played in this season’s first 11 games, logging 28 tackles with a sack.

Cincinnati added depth by signing free agent DT Nick Hayden to the roster. Hayden (6-4, 292; Wisconsin) is classified a third-year NFL player. He was a sixth-round selection by Carolina in the 2008 draft. He spent most of his rookie year on the practice squad, played in 10 games with two stars in 2009 and played in 14 games with 10 starts last season. He opened 2011 training camp with Carolina and was waived on Sept. 3. His NFL totals include 26 games, 13 starts, 85 tackles and 2.0 sacks.

The Bengals also signed DT Swanson Miller to the practice squad. Miller (6-4, 310; Oklahoma State) is classified a first-year NFL player. He entered the league in April of 2010 as a college free agent with Cleveland and was waived at the conclusion of preseason. He was signed to the New Orleans practice squad in December of 2010, was signed the New Orleans offseason roster for 2011 and opened ’11 training camp with the Saints. He was waived on Sept. 4. He has spent time this regular season on both the New Orleans and Tampa Bay practice squads.

Cincinnati released rookie DT Cornell Banks of Fresno State from the practice squad. Banks had been signed to the practice squad on Nov. 29.
